I've picked up a few nice copies from The Golden Period recently, including, just yesterday, a mint quadrophonic copy of DSOTM that the woman in Glebe market had mistakenly assumed was a bog standard, well preserved stereo copy.

Ten ****ing dollars man.

Should have been at least $80 or $90, by my reckoning. Pretty chuffed.

Also picked up a green vinyl promo of WYWH, originally sent to radio stations in advance of the album release. There's a blue copy of DSOTM in the same shop, so that'll be the next essential.

Individually numbered, no cover.

Now if only I had access to a record player.

I'd be interested in hearing if you guys have any rarities of an official nature and not just bootlegs or whathaveyou.

Good searching, fixxlevy.
I've got a mint condition STEREO copy of Dark Side of the Moon, which cost me $9.99 at my local vinyl place. It came with the posters and stickers, too. The only reason I supposed it was so cheap was the fact that it was a Capitol 'rainbow label' release, which I think came out in 1992 or therabouts.
But the cool part is this... there are slight differences in the mix on this LP than the regular CD and orginal LP release. There are too many differences than I can post here, but I'll point some out if anyone would like to know.

BTW, fixxlevy: First, go buy that blue vinyl DSOTM promo. Then, go out and buy a decent record player. Trust me, you will not be disappointed. LPs get better sound than CDs in some situations, especially if you want more bass. LPs are awesome.

Um, I bought a copy of A Nice Pair recently, but I don't believe it has everything it originally had. It's the copy with the "W.R.Phang Dental Surgeon" window in the top right. It came with the Piper at the Gates of Dawn and Saucerful of Secrets vinyls in clear lining. Inside I also found and empty lining that had the cover of Piper on one side and the cover of saucerful and the opposing side. If anybody can help me out with this, I would appreciate it.

Oh, on the back of the cover on the top left, it says "Contains the previously released LP "A Saucerfull of Secrets" plus selectrions from "Pink Floyd", "Relics", and "Ummagumma", plus the single, "Flaming", never before available on LP". I am also currently without the apparatus to play the LP, so am unsure if these "selections" are on the Saucerful LP, but it doesn't have any other tracks aside from the usuals on the vinyl listing.
